WEG to unveil smart motor and drive technologies at Water Equipment Show 2025

WEG, the global leader in motor and drives, will present its latest water management solutions at The Water Equipment Show 2025, which takes place at the Telford International Centre, Telford, UK, on May 15, 2025.

At Stand S22 attendees can explore WEG’s advancements in motion drives, control solutions and digital technologies designed to enhance efficiency and sustainability in the water industry.

The Water Equipment Show is a leading UK event showcasing water and wastewater equipment, services and solutions from top suppliers. Highlights at WEG’s Stand S22 will include its Water Industry Mechanical and Electrical Specifications (WIMES)-compliant W22 motor range, which delivers high performance, robust specifications and maximum energy efficiency — all supported by a three-year warranty.

WEG’s W22 range of three-phase induction motors are built for the most severe operating conditions, such as marine and saline environments. Their mechanical design not only optimises characteristics such as weight and length, but also adds durability and easy maintenance for use in remote regions. Available with IE3 and IE4 efficiency, the motors are used in critical water processes such as water feeding and recirculation processes in desalination plants.

Additionally, WEG will showcase its energy-efficient W23 Sync+ and W80 AXgen motors, paired with the CFW900 variable speed drive (VSD). The W23 Sync+ delivers superior efficiency through its hybrid permanent magnet (PM) and synchronous reluctance (SynRM) technology, exceeding the anticipated IE6 efficiency levels.

“The Water Equipment Show 2025 is an excellent opportunity to showcase how intelligent motor and drive solutions can transform water management,” said Marek Lukaszczyk, WEG UK & Middle East Marketing Manager. “Our advanced motor and drive technologies are designed to not only reduce energy consumption, but also help customers achieve measurable environmental goals without compromising performance.”

From an automation perspective, WEG will feature the CFW11 and CFW500 VSDs equipped with Pump Genius software. Pump Genius transforms a VSD into an intelligent pumping system, which ensures precise pressure and flow control throughout the wastewater treatment process. Uncontrolled pressure flows can be detected early to avoid serious damage to pumps, pipelines and fittings.

Another key innovation is WEGSEE+, an advanced software tool designed for energy management and sustainability analysis. WEGSEE+ enables users to assess energy savings potential, calculate return on investment and analyse greenhouse gas (GHG) emission reductions, empowering companies to make data-driven decisions that optimise resource efficiency.

Visitors can also explore WEG’s advanced digital solutions through a demonstration of the cloud-based Motion Fleet Management (MFM) system. MFM integrates with WEGscan sensors for real-time monitoring and predictive maintenance.

“WEG returns to this year’s Water Equipment Show with a stronger portfolio than ever,” said Lukaszczyk. “From motors that exceed IE6 efficiency levels to solar-powered pumping solutions, we’re helping the water sector become more efficient, resilient and future-ready.”
